, including all inherited members.
current_pan_speed | asr_flir_ptu_driver::PTUDriverMock | [private] |
current_tilt_speed | asr_flir_ptu_driver::PTUDriverMock | [private] |
determineLegitEndPoint(double end_point_pan_candidate, double end_point_tilt_candidate) | asr_flir_ptu_driver::PTUDriverMock | [virtual] |
forbidden_areas | asr_flir_ptu_driver::PTUDriver | [protected] |
getAngleSpeed(char type) | asr_flir_ptu_driver::PTUDriverMock | [virtual] |
getCurrentAngle(char type) | asr_flir_ptu_driver::PTUDriverMock | [virtual] |
getDesiredAngle(char type) | asr_flir_ptu_driver::PTUDriverMock | [virtual] |
getErrorString(char status_code) | asr_flir_ptu_driver::PTUDriver | [protected, virtual] |
getLimitAngle(char pan_or_tilt, char upper_or_lower) | asr_flir_ptu_driver::PTUDriverMock | [virtual] |
hasHalted() | asr_flir_ptu_driver::PTUDriverMock | [virtual] |
hasHaltedAndReachedGoal() | asr_flir_ptu_driver::PTUDriverMock | [virtual] |
is_stopped_count | asr_flir_ptu_driver::PTUDriverMock | [private] |
isConnected() | asr_flir_ptu_driver::PTUDriverMock | [virtual] |
isInForbiddenArea(double pan_angle, double tilt_angle) | asr_flir_ptu_driver::PTUDriver | [virtual] |
isInSpeedControlMode() | asr_flir_ptu_driver::PTUDriverMock | [virtual] |
isWithinPanTiltLimits(double pan, double tilt) | asr_flir_ptu_driver::PTUDriverMock | [virtual] |
pan_acceleration | asr_flir_ptu_driver::PTUDriverMock | [private] |
pan_angle | asr_flir_ptu_driver::PTUDriverMock | [private] |
pan_base | asr_flir_ptu_driver::PTUDriverMock | [private] |
pan_distance | asr_flir_ptu_driver::PTUDriverMock | [private] |
pan_max | asr_flir_ptu_driver::PTUDriver | [protected] |
pan_max_limit | asr_flir_ptu_driver::PTUDriverMock | [private] |
pan_min | asr_flir_ptu_driver::PTUDriver | [protected] |
pan_min_limit | asr_flir_ptu_driver::PTUDriverMock | [private] |
pan_resolution | asr_flir_ptu_driver::PTUDriver | [protected] |
pan_speed | asr_flir_ptu_driver::PTUDriverMock | [private] |
prefetched_pan_current_base | asr_flir_ptu_driver::PTUDriver | [protected] |
prefetched_pan_current_position | asr_flir_ptu_driver::PTUDriver | [protected] |
prefetched_pan_desired_acceleration | asr_flir_ptu_driver::PTUDriver | [protected] |
prefetched_pan_desired_speed | asr_flir_ptu_driver::PTUDriver | [protected] |
prefetched_tilt_current_base | asr_flir_ptu_driver::PTUDriver | [protected] |
prefetched_tilt_current_position | asr_flir_ptu_driver::PTUDriver | [protected] |
prefetched_tilt_desired_acceleration | asr_flir_ptu_driver::PTUDriver | [protected] |
prefetched_tilt_desired_speed | asr_flir_ptu_driver::PTUDriver | [protected] |
PTUDriver(const char *port, int baud, bool speed_control) | asr_flir_ptu_driver::PTUDriver | |
PTUDriver() | asr_flir_ptu_driver::PTUDriver | |
PTUDriverMock(const char *port, int baud, bool speed_control) | asr_flir_ptu_driver::PTUDriverMock | |
reachedGoal() | asr_flir_ptu_driver::PTUDriverMock | [virtual] |
setAbsoluteAngles(double pan_angle, double tilt_angle, bool no_forbidden_area_check) | asr_flir_ptu_driver::PTUDriverMock | [virtual] |
setAbsoluteAngleSpeeds(double pan_speed, double tilt_speed) | asr_flir_ptu_driver::PTUDriverMock | [virtual] |
setAbsoluteAngleSpeeds(signed short pan_speed, signed short tilt_speed) | asr_flir_ptu_driver::PTUDriverMock | [virtual] |
setComputationTolerance(double computation_tolerance) | asr_flir_ptu_driver::PTUDriver | [virtual] |
setDistanceFactor(long distance_factor) | asr_flir_ptu_driver::PTUDriver | [virtual] |
setForbiddenAreas(std::vector< std::map< std::string, double > > forbidden_areas) | asr_flir_ptu_driver::PTUDriver | [virtual] |
setLimitAngles(double pan_min, double pan_max, double tilt_min, double tilt_max) | asr_flir_ptu_driver::PTUDriverMock | [virtual] |
setLimitAnglesToHardwareConstraints() | asr_flir_ptu_driver::PTUDriverMock | [virtual] |
setSettings(int pan_base, int tilt_base, int pan_speed, int tilt_speed, int pan_upper, int tilt_upper, int pan_accel, int tilt_accel, int pan_hold, int tilt_hold, int pan_move, int tilt_move) | asr_flir_ptu_driver::PTUDriverMock | [virtual] |
setSpeedControlMode(bool speed_control_mode) | asr_flir_ptu_driver::PTUDriverMock | [virtual] |
setValuesOutOfLimitsButWithinMarginToLimit(double *pan, double *tilt, double margin) | asr_flir_ptu_driver::PTUDriverMock | [virtual] |
tilt_acceleration | asr_flir_ptu_driver::PTUDriverMock | [private] |
tilt_angle | asr_flir_ptu_driver::PTUDriverMock | [private] |
tilt_base | asr_flir_ptu_driver::PTUDriverMock | [private] |
tilt_distance | asr_flir_ptu_driver::PTUDriverMock | [private] |
tilt_max | asr_flir_ptu_driver::PTUDriver | [protected] |
tilt_max_limit | asr_flir_ptu_driver::PTUDriverMock | [private] |
tilt_min | asr_flir_ptu_driver::PTUDriver | [protected] |
tilt_min_limit | asr_flir_ptu_driver::PTUDriverMock | [private] |
tilt_resolution | asr_flir_ptu_driver::PTUDriver | [protected] |
tilt_speed | asr_flir_ptu_driver::PTUDriverMock | [private] |
~PTUDriver() | asr_flir_ptu_driver::PTUDriver | |
~PTUDriverMock() | asr_flir_ptu_driver::PTUDriverMock | |